PDA

Ver la Versión Completa : sumar dos edit


arespremium
31-07-2007, 03:06:50
hola vuelvo con otro programa sencillo
quiero sumar dos campos, edit1 y edit2 al sumar que muestre el resultado en un label1.caption

Tengo problema en la operacion con la suma.

Usando esto:
Edit1
Edit2
Button1 (aceptar)
Button2 (borrar)
Button3 (cerrar)
Label1

Sumar
n1:=strtoint(Edit1.text);
n2:=strtoint(Edit2.text);
suma:=n1+n2
label1.caption='la suma es= '+inttostr(suma);


borrar:
begin
edit1.clear;
edit2.clear;
label1.caption:='';
edit1.setfocus;
end;

cerrar:
begin
close;
end;

Saludos

ver_imagen_1 (http://www.subirimagenes.com/imagenes/previo/thump_1312115delphi_sumar_a.gif)
ver_imagen_2 (http://www.subirimagenes.com/imagenes/previo/thump_1312116delphi_sumar_b.gif)

Caral
31-07-2007, 03:37:37
Hola
Primero que nada, no entiendo por que pones esto en un hilo en el foro de Internet?.
Ahora, no veo el problema, mas bien lo tienes muy claro, un par de retoques y ya.

procedure TForm1.Button1Click(Sender: TObject);
Var
n1,n2,suma: Integer;
begin
n1:=strtoint(Edit1.text);
n2:=strtoint(Edit2.text);
suma:= n1 + n2;
label1.caption:='la suma es= '+inttostr(suma);
end;

Saludos

Neftali [Germán.Estévez]
31-07-2007, 09:32:10
Sólo una cosa que no me queda clara...
¿Te estamos hacendo los deberes del "cole"?:D:D

arespremium
01-08-2007, 02:20:06
Sólo una cosa que no me queda clara...
¿Te estamos hacendo los deberes del "cole"?:D:D

En el cole me enseñaron visual basic 6, descubri delphi y lo escuentro mucho mejor que visual basic 6

Caral
01-08-2007, 03:01:00
Hola
Y bueno, sirvio, no sirvio el ejemplo.
Es politica del club, por lo menos asi lo he visto, indicar si la cosa camino o no, ya que otras personas ven los hilos, tal vez con la misma duda y quieren saber en que paro el asunto, asi aprenden mejor.
En otras palabras, terminar el asunto.
Saludos

ArdiIIa
01-08-2007, 03:08:25
En el cole me enseñaron visual basic 6, descubri delphi y lo escuentro mucho mejor que visual basic 6

Pues eso está, pero que muy bien, a medida que profuncides, te gustará mas.

Por cierto, en vez de IntToStr, te recomiendo que utilices IntToStrDef, de este modo evitarás o controlarás que la entrada de teclado se ajusten a números y evitarás errores.